Creative “Pixel Stretch” Navigation Set

Advertisement

1. Create a new document.

First of all create a new document, use any regular banner size (I’ve used 530×140)

Download this 3D render and open it in Photoshop, now copy it into the new document.

2. Duplicate the render

With the Single Column Marquee Tool do some pixel-streching to the render.

Duplicate the main render, apply Filter > Brush Strokes > Spatter with any old settings, set the layer mode to Lighten and erase a few parts with a soft brush.

Duplicate the render again, move it up to the right a bit and set the layer mode to Darken

Pixel stretch a part of the document again to the right

To bring out the detail a bit apply Filter > Sharpen > Sharpen

This is what it would look like if you applied Spatter to the pixel stretched layer and stretched it again

3. More details

Duplicate the render layer again and set the layer mode to Lighten

Stretch a part again and maybe use the Dodge tool to lighten up a part or two

Create a Curves Layer ( Layer > New Adjustment Layer > Curves… )

This is what I made from that particular part:
